The Fall issue of Bal Harbour Magazine has arrived, and we couldn’t be more excited to give you the first look!

Digging right into this season’s must-haves, fashion influencers and content creators Tamu McPherson and Chloe King share their top picks in a special interview held over Zoom.

And it just so happens that one of McPherson’s favorite stylists, Ramya Giangola, is profiled in this issue. One of three powerhouses featured in our Style Setters column—joined by Katie Sturino and Rachael Wang—the three take us on a tour of their wardrobes, wish lists and what a day at Bal Harbour Shops looks like for them.

No issue of Bal Harbour Magazine would be complete without turning a spotlight on fashion illustration. And this issue we really lit up our pages with the launch of the BHS Creative Challenge, where we invited artists to submit their fashion-inspired illustrations for a chance to be published. Famed artist and illustrator Ruben Toledo helped us pick the winner, Claudia Radvanyi, whose work you can see here.

We also round up a few must-follow wellness gurus, talk about resilience with a leading professor in the field, share a tender discussion about friendship with authors and pals Fanny Singer and Aminatou Sow, profile the creative directors of Balenciaga and Marni, meet Brazil’s ultimate fashion influencer, check in with Artistic Director Alessandro Sartori on the 110th anniversary of Ermenegildo Zegna, talk to stylist Shiona Turini about everything from “insecure” to secret set tricks (spoiler: dry cleaner sticks will become your new best friend), take a look back at the enduring influence of the palm-leaf print and ask the legendary Lynn Yaeger to share a bit of fashion nostalgia with us.

When it comes to Tiffany & Co.’s high jewelry collection, the bird is the word. First introduced by Jean Schlumberger for Tiffany in 1965, the Bird on a Rock brooch epitomizes joy, optimism and possibilities—and now serves as the inspiration for a collection of necklaces, rings, earrings, and bracelets.
